Life was actually quite boring.

Especially when it came to ending someone else's life, there was no joy to speak of.

Every time Rorschach killed someone, that was what he thought.

With a pure smile, the young man walked out of Room 403, but behind him was a blazing fire.

There was nothing faster than a simple question.

"Did you betray me?"

When the other party gave a definite answer, the child-faced young man would give them another choice.

"Ask your conscience, your guilt. Do you think you deserve to die?"

At this moment, the other party had many choices, but usually, they would try to justify themselves.

"I don't want to do this, I have a lot of reasons too. Someone threatened me, the management wasn't strict enough, that's why we are like this, we only took it because others took it."

But no one could lie to themselves, no one could lie with their soul …

"I broke my oath, I deserve to die."

"No, I'm not at that level."

The soul gave the interrogator an instant answer. Most people answered the latter, and the minority who answered the former … Rorschach would fulfill their wishes on the spot.

When the interrogator realized something was wrong, it was probably too late.

The victim's divine power network was cut off, and their external contact was close to zero. All the waves that had just started were returned to silence.

The young man would not forget to ask before completing the mission, "Are you related to Rorschach's assassination? Did you leak Rorschach's location and information? "

When Rorschach cleared the names of the higher-ups on the list, he still did not get a definite answer.

But soon, he got the answer from the low-level personnel who were involved.

A driver saw Rorschach's car enter the building and sold out his location to the bounty hunter. He was not the only one who did so.

A guard on night patrol saw that the light in Rorschach's room was still on, and a cook asked Rorschach if he wanted supper … A simple half-month salary made them betray their employer without hesitation.

Perhaps, this was no longer their problem. It just so happened that they had encountered an "opportunity".

Maybe, to them, this was just a side effect of their daily work.

Perhaps, from the very beginning, there was no such thing as loyalty.

After the initial shock, Rorschach was now quite open-minded. Since there was no reward for loyalty in the past, it was natural for him to betray the present without any cost.

There were no mature laws and rules to begin with. Everyone was playing by the rules of the jungle. Rorschach couldn't say anything.

However, since there were no restrictions, Rorschach naturally followed the most primitive rules.

Kill the chicken to warn the monkey, kill one to warn the hundred, the cost was low and the effect was quick.

It was just that many people needed to reflect on whether they had developed too quickly and neglected many things.

In the near future, not only the Game Church, but all the factions in the entire city would have to undergo a major rectification and purge.

Now that things had developed to this point, the assassination of Rorschach was no longer important. Rectification and internal policy adjustment had become the most important task at hand.

Power and wealth would change people. Some people had already become what they hated the most in the past.

Rorschach didn't need to care about the reform. There were professionals to do it. Now that he was free, Rorschach conveniently cut off many rotten branches and leaves.

From the place where the news was leaked, Rorschach followed the clues and searched everywhere. In the end, the clues were often cut off at a phone booth that no one cared about, an intelligence dealer whose real name was unknown, and a mercenary who only had a code name.

As he fished for small fish and prawns, the fishing line was completely cut off.

Lori used her divine power to divine, but she couldn't get any results. This could only mean that there was definitely a big boss behind the other party.

During the investigation, Rorschach, who had no identity, also obtained many unexpected gains.

"The Gray Chamber of Commerce and the Heaven's Eye Mercenary Group?"

These two names weren't new information from the traitor, but completely unexpected gains.

The former was the biggest smuggler in the city. Every day, a huge amount of smuggled goods entered and left through them. They had the right to exempt all goods in the city from inspection.

If high-energy Magic Cores, which were obviously prohibited goods, could enter the city without anyone noticing, they were the most likely to do so.

"Tsk, they can smuggle anything? How arrogant. Do they have a backer? "

[Yes, the strongest church in this city … The Game Church. Are you surprised? Are you surprised?]

“.....”

Rorschach didn't know how to react. He just smiled.

"… Who's in charge?"

[Cohen Fagus. You only came out of his house six hours ago.]

"Tsk, he didn't say anything."

[You didn't give him a chance to speak. You didn't ask.]

Alright, at this moment, Rorschach even suspected that he had killed someone to silence them.

[I've already sent people to investigate. However, don't expect to find anything.]

Rorschach knew what was going on, so he didn't have high hopes.

As for the Heaven's Eye Mercenary Group, it was even more subtle.

They were a mercenary group in the city. More than seventy percent of the members were natives of Cape Town. They had some connections with the low-level people involved in this incident. It was probably the extent of economic transactions. The relationship wasn't deep and there was no evidence.

Rorschach saw them as the key because of the "Heaven's Eye", the "Eye" business card that was left in someone's house.

"Maybe I'm oversensitive. Now when I think of 'Eye' or something, I always think of that …"

[Same for me. It's hard not to be suspicious of a name like that.]

"If it's really involved, there's no need to change the name. Isn't this actively exposing it?"

[You still expect the Evil God's followers to have brains? Don't you think this feels similar to the past?]

Rorschach nodded. This was indeed a familiar feeling.

Then, the next step was simple. He just had to take out the Heaven's Eye and put it under the sun one by one.
